Summary
First-time homebuyer tax credit. Creates a tax credit for taxable years 2024 through 2028 for individuals or married couples filing jointly who sell residential real property that is the taxpayer's primary residence and is located in the Commonwealth to a first-time homebuyer, as defined by the bill. Such credit will be equal to two percent of the sales price of the property, not to exceed $5,000.
